Item 8.01 Other Events
KinerjaPay Corp (OTCBB: KPAY), an Indonesian-based Delaware corporation engaged
in e-commerce and digital payment services, among other businesses, today
announced in a press release attached as Exhibit 99.1 hereto, a that the Company
has signed a new Indonesian bituminous coal contract with a China Construction
Investment Group (Ningbo) Trading Co., Ltd. for a contract to supply up to
2,000,000 Metric Tons (MT) in or about 12 weeks. The agreement with China
Construction Investment Group (Ningbo) Trading Co., Ltd is attached as Exhibit
10.39 hereto.
As reported in the press release, the contract's unit price for the grade of
Indonesian Bituminous Coal in bulk subject to the agreement is USD$51.50 /MT
based upon present pricing, with an initial shipment quantity of 80,000 MT,
representing a total shipment value for this initial shipment of approximately
USD$4,120,000 with planned future orders and a delivery schedule on a bi-weekly
basis. KinerjaPay expects to deliver the contract in full and, as a result,
expects total gross revenues of up to USD$103 million in 2021(which estimate is
dependent on the Coal Price Index throughout the year), from which the Company
anticipates generating operating profits of approximately USD$10 million in
2021.
